2012-06-27 47 views
0

我有一個UIViewController行動,當被調用時,創建(完全代碼)UITableView可能2或3行(沒有花哨),與一個頁眉和頁腳,並使2或3簡單UILabels那些。然後將此UITableView添加爲活動UIViewController上主視圖的子視圖。在模擬器上需要大約3秒才能執行此操作並實際顯示此UITableView。創建UIView和子視圖花費幾秒鐘是否正常?

這是正常的嗎?

+3

不,這不是...... – borrrden

+1

謝謝。這就是我需要知道的。 – dan

回答

2

不,這絕對不正常。你需要確切地分離出所有的時間。一個非常簡單的方法就是在你的代碼的不同地方撒NSLog調用,這樣你就可以看到什麼時候調用。這可能足以讓你開始。

最終,您可能需要一些更復雜的計時代碼,您可以使用它來分析事情。我爲此使用了this code的變體。

相關問題